Re: Making a query from 2 tables at same time
От | Richard Huxton |
---|---|
Тема | Re: Making a query from 2 tables at same time |
Дата | |
Msg-id | 474EDFFB.6050608@archonet.com обсуждение исходный текст |
Ответ на | Re: Making a query from 2 tables at same time ("Pau Marc Munoz Torres" <paumarc@gmail.com>) |
Ответы |
Re: Making a query from 2 tables at same time
|
Список | pgsql-general |
Pau Marc Munoz Torres wrote: > i test it and now the error is > > mhc2db=> select t1.sp, t1.pos,t2.p1, t2.p4, t2.p6, t2.p7, t2.p9 from local > as t1, precalc as t2 where t1.ce='ACIAD' and idr(t2.p1, t2.p4, t2.p6, t2.p7, > t2.p9, 'HLA-DRB5*0101')>2; > ERROR: relation "pssms" does not exist > CONTEXT: SQL statement "SELECT score from PSSMS where AA= $1 and POS=1 > and MOLEC= $2 " > PL/pgSQL function "idr" line 11 at select into variables > > pssm was a temporary table that i used to calculate the index in precalc > table with idr function, should i rebuilt it? the problem is that if i can't > use idr as an index it eill be to slow I think you need to take a step back and explain what it is you are trying to do - you shouldn't be using an external table in an indexed function at all. -- Richard Huxton Archonet Ltd
В списке pgsql-general по дате отправления: